Ranking Methodology
Each vendor in this ranking has been evaluated across five objective criteria, weighted by their importance to laboratory research quality:
- COA Verification Rate (30% weight): Percentage of vendor-supplied Certificates of Analysis that were confirmed accurate when cross-referenced against independent laboratory testing. A COA verification rate above 90% indicates reliable batch documentation.
- HPLC Purity Consistency (25% weight): Variance between vendor-claimed HPLC purity values and independently measured purity via reversed-phase HPLC with UV detection at 220 nm. Vendors with less than 2% absolute deviation score highest.
- Price Transparency (15% weight): Clarity and accessibility of pricing information, including per-milligram cost, bulk pricing structures, and absence of hidden fees such as undisclosed handling or reconstitution charges.
- Shipping Coverage and Reliability (15% weight): Geographic reach, average delivery times, packaging quality (cold chain maintenance, desiccant inclusion), and shipment tracking availability.
- Documentation Quality (15% weight): Completeness of batch records including HPLC chromatograms, mass spectrometry data, amino acid analysis results, solubility notes, and storage recommendations.
Independent Testing Partners
All independent verification testing for this ranking was performed by two accredited analytical laboratories:
- Janoshik Analytical: Specializing in HPLC purity analysis, mass spectrometry confirmation, and amino acid composition verification for peptide compounds. Janoshik operates independently from all vendors evaluated in this ranking.
- MZ Biolabs: Providing complementary analytical services including endotoxin testing (LAL assay per USP <85>), heavy metal screening (ICP-MS per ICH Q3D), and peptide identity confirmation via MALDI-TOF mass spectrometry.
Samples for testing were purchased anonymously through standard customer channels. No vendor was notified of testing in advance, and no vendor received preferential treatment during the evaluation process.

Frequently Asked Questions
What criteria should I prioritize when selecting a peptide vendor?
Prioritize analytical transparency (batch-specific CoAs with raw data), verified purity claims through third-party testing, clear research-use-only labeling, responsive customer and scientific support, and a trackable supply chain. Price should be a secondary consideration after quality verification.
How often should vendor rankings be re-evaluated?
Vendor quality can change. Re-evaluate annually or whenever you notice changes in CoA quality, shipping reliability, or customer service responsiveness. Independent third-party testing of periodic orders provides objective data for ongoing vendor assessment.
Is it better to use one vendor or diversify?
For critical research, having two or three verified vendors provides supply chain resilience. A single vendor relationship may offer better pricing and consistency, but creates a single point of failure. Diversification also enables cross-vendor quality comparison through independent testing.
Do vendor certifications guarantee peptide quality?
Certifications like ISO 9001 and GMP indicate quality management systems are in place but do not guarantee individual batch quality. They are a positive signal, not proof. Always verify quality through batch-specific analytical data and periodic independent testing, regardless of a vendor's certification status.
